A total of 11 candidates have been given the go-ahead by the NFF Electoral Committee 2022 to run for Nigeria Football Federation (NFF) President in the elections, which are set for Friday, September 30, in Benin City.

Barr.  Seyi Akinwunmi, the current first Vice President, is at the top of the list. Mallam Shehu Dikko, the current 2nd Vice President; Alhaji Ibrahim Musa Gusau, the current Chairman of Chairmen; Suleiman Yahaya-Kwande, the current Member of Board; and Barr. Musa Amadu the previous General Secretary,with Dr. Christian Emeruwa, the Confederation of African Football’s Director of Safety and Security.

Former NFF First Vice President, Mazi Amanze Uchegbulam, Chairman of the FCT Football Association, Mallam Adam Mouktar Mohammed, former Nigerian International Goalkeeper, Peterside Idah, former Chairman of Kano Pillars FC and renowned technocrat, Alhaji Abba Abdullahi Yola and UK-based David-Buhari Doherty have also been approved for the exalted position, which will be vacated by FIFA Council Member, Amaju Melvin Pinnick.

Due to an invalid nomination, Mr. Paul Yusuf of Plateau State was disqualified, for the same reason, Mr. Marcellinus Anyanwu of Imo State was eliminated from the race.

Three persons, viz current Member of Board, Chief Felix Anyansi-Agwu; current Member of Board, Senator Obinna Ogba and; Mr Chinedu Okoye will battle for the post of 1st Vice President.

Current Member of Board, Alhaji Yusuf Ahmed ‘Fresh’ was the only one who obtained the form, and has been cleared for, the position of Chairman of Chairmen.

Contesting for seats on the Executive Committee from the South East are Pastor Emeka Inyama (Abia State); Mr. Chikelue Iloenyosi (Anambra State); Mr Karibe Pascal Ojigwe (Abia State); Mr Jude Benjamin Obikwelu (Anambra State) and; Sir Emmanuel Ochiagha (Imo State).

For North Central are Alhaji Mohammed Alkali (Nasarawa State); Rt. Hon. Margaret Icheen (Benue State); Hon. Idris Abdullahi Musa (Kwara State); Mr Daniel Amokachi (Benue State) and; Mr Benedict Akwuegbu (Plateau State).

Current Member of Board, Ms Aisha Falode tops the list of candidates from the South-South region, with Chief Kenneth Nwaomucha (Delta State); Mr. Gregory Abang (Cross River State); Mr. Roland Abu Omomoh (Edo State); Barr. Poubeni Ogun (Bayelsa State); Mr Jarret Tenebe (Edo State) and Rt. Hon. Essien Udofot (Akwa Ibom State) also vying for seats from that zone.
